Sierżant, (Sierzant)
a WinBoard compliant chess engine by Mariusz Rostek, written in C++ and first released in November 2004 [1]. Sierżant was described in Mariusz' 2008 Diploma thesis [2]. It is the successor of the weaker Szeregowiec, and predecessor of the stronger Porucznik - in dependence to the Polish Armed Forces ranking.

Board Representation
The board is represented by a 10x10 array, move generation is done in conjunction with piece lists and Table-driven Move Generation.Search
Sierżant performs PVS alpha-beta with null-move pruning and razoring inside an iterative deepening loop, and extends consecutive checks up to five times inside one variation. Despite it has no transposition table, additive 32-bit Zobrist keys are used to detect repetitions. After first playing the principal variation from the previous iteration, move ordering is improved by the killer heuristic and MVV-LVA for captures. The material balance is calculated incrementally and passed as parameter to the recursive alpha-beta routine. Positional considerations, notably piece-square tables including king safety versus king centralization and pawn structure related stuff, are dependent on the game phase, pre-determined at the root before starting the search, that is opening, middle and endgame, separated by the total amount of material on the board.See also
